Market Likely Underestimates Evolution Mining's Costs in FY 2027

2341 GMT - While the market waits on copper-and-gold producer Evolution Mining's FY 2027 guidance, UBS expects cost estimates to rise. Analyst Levi Spry says consensus forecasts are for all-in sustaining costs of A$1,710/oz. That's well below UBS's A$1,930/oz estimate. UBS's FY 2027 gold-production forecast of 704,000 oz is broadly in line with market expectations of 701,000 oz. However, UBS anticipates output of some 57,000 tons of copper compared to consensus hopes of 70,000 tons. "Beyond a 10% throughput reduction at Ernest Henry as development ramps up post the FY26 weather events, Cowal is transitioning to stockpile processing, with limited growth elsewhere to offset the impact in FY27," UBS says. It has a neutral call on Evolution, which ended Wednesday at A$11.34. (david.winning@wsj.com; @dwinningWSJ)
